Overview

Easily and efficiently isolate highly purified pan T cells from fresh or previously frozen non-human primate peripheral blood mononuclear cell (PBMC) samples by immunomagnetic negative selection, with the EasySep? Non-Human Primate T Cell Isolation Kit. Widely used in published research for more than 20 years, EasySep? combines the specificity of monoclonal antibodies with the simplicity of a column-free magnetic system.

In this EasySep? negative selection procedure, unwanted cells are labeled with antibody complexes and magnetic particles. The following unwanted cells are targeted for removal: B cells, NK cells, monocytes, granulocytes, mast cells, dendritic cells, hematopoietic progenitors, and platelets. The magnetically labeled cells are then separated from the untouched desired T cells by using an EasySep? magnet and simply pouring or pipetting the desired cells into a new tube. Following magnetic cell isolation in as little as 20 minutes, the desired T cells are ready for downstream applications such as flow cytometry, culture, or DNA/RNA extraction.

This kit has been verified for use with rhesus and cynomolgus macaques.

Data Figures

The content of rhesus macaque CD3+ T cells before and after isolation correspond to 55.7% and 93.9%, respectively.

Figure 1. EasySep? Non-Human Primate T Cell Isolation Kit

In this example, starting with rhesus macaque PBMCs, the T cell content (within the CD45+ gate) of start and final isolated fractions are 55.7% and 93.9%, respectively.
